I prefer to close the fuel valve and let the engine finish using up the fuel in the line and carburetor bowl because it keeps it clean instead of allowing the fuel to get old and contaminate the fuel jets in the carburetor
One ounce of Seafoam liquid product p/gal often works into the system to 'ungum' the line and carb system. Sold at most hardware and convenience/gas station stores. Priced at 7.99- 11.99 per 16oz can. Also haven't had to change a sparkplug in ANY of my 2 or 4 cycles since I started using it as regular fuel additive for the last 8-9 years. That's JD rider/lawn tractor, snow blowers, push mower, leaf blower, chainsaw, emergency gas generator, hedge trimmer .. etc. They key is adding 1 oz to every gallon of gas as a regular thing.
